2009 House Bill 4096 / Public Act 10

Authorize search warrants for arrest warrant subjects

Introduced in the House

Jan. 22, 2009

Introduced by Rep. Richard LeBlanc (D-18)

To authorize search warrants where the search is for an individual subject to a bench warrant or arrest warrant for a criminal offense..
